  1. David Wright Miliband (born 15 July 1965) is the president and chief executive officer (CEO) of the International Rescue Committee and a former British Labour Party politician. [1] He was the Foreign Secretary from 2007 to 2010 [2] and the Member of Parliament (MP) for South Shields in North East England from 2001 to 2013.
